Ephesians 4:11 And he gave some, apostles; and some, prophets; and some, evangelists; and some, pastors and teachers;
12 For the perfecting of the saints, for the work of the ministry, for the edifying of the body of Christ:
13 Till we all come in the unity of the faith, and of the knowledge of the Son of God, unto a perfect man, unto the measure of the stature of the fulness of Christ:
14 That we henceforth be no more children, tossed to and fro, and carried about with every wind of doctrine, by the sleight of men, and cunning craftiness, whereby they lie in wait to deceive;
15 But speaking the truth in love, may grow up into him in all things, which is the head, even Christ:
16 From whom the whole body fitly joined together and compacted by that which every joint supplieth, according to the effectual working in the measure of every part, maketh increase of the body unto the edifying of itself in love.
It takes the ministry of the Pastor to prefect the saints. Without the saints be perfected they cannot do the work of the ministry. Without the work of the ministry the body of Christ cannot be edified.
We can never measure up to the stature of the fulness of Christ without the ministry of the Pastor.
Without the ministry of the Pastor people are blown about and tossed to and fro with every wild doctrine that is out there.
There is just no substitute for God's divine plan of maturity for believers!
